linux hosting web hosting managed hosting free website ecommerce hosting streaming server hosting cheap web hosting free web hosting webmaster tool dedicated server front page hosting windows hosting cpanel hosting asp hosting reseller hosting affordable web hosting domain name registration shared hosting cpanel